  • HT5330 I already have iCloud set up with 10.7 but can't receive email

    I already have iCloud set up with 10.7 but can't receive email. Suggestions?

    hildigirl wrote:
    smtp.me.com:name and then  (Offline) after
    That is (or was) a Mobile Me server, now closed down. The correct servers are
    imap.mail.me.com and smtp.mail.me.com (outgoing), but this should have been set automatically, did you completely sign out of iCloud (System Preferences>iCloud and is Mail activated in Mail, Contacts and Calendars as well as iCloud?
    If you are still signed in at System Preferences>Mobile Me, sign out.

  • 8520 will connect with internet via wifi but won't receive or send emails

    have recently changed my carrier/service provider and all is set up to recieve texts, use the internet (default setting to hotspot) but now won't let me send or receive emails. I've gone to email set up in setup and tried to re-establish my email link but it keeps saying 'your device had a problem connecting to the server' - how can this be when it connects to tthe server for normal internet use?
    Any ideas gratefully recieved.
    thanks

    On your BlackBerry device, go to:
    1. Options > Advanced > Host Routing Table > Menu > Register.
    2. Resend your service books from your carrier BIS site:
    From your handheld device:   http://www.blackberry.com/btsc/KB15402
    Go to the Personal Email Set Up icon and log in. Then under Help!, select Service Books, then select Send service Books.
    From your desktop PC:  http://www.blackberry.com/btsc/KB02830
    North American Carriers - scroll down to select your carrier
    WorldWide Carriers - Find your carrier on the list
    3. With the BlackBerry device powered ON, remove the battery a few seconds and then reinsert the battery to reboot. This reboot, even if you have already done this, is often needed to install the service books.

  • HT1694 I changed my hotmail password. I then changed that password in settings, it receives emails on my iPad but won't send emails and gives me message that my password is incorrect.

    I changed my hotmail password. I then changed the password in settings, now my device iPad will receive emails but gives me an error message when I send emails that password is incorrect. How do I fix it?

    Try this. Go deeper into the settings.
    Check the outgoing mail server setting. Make sure that your username and password are in there.
    Settings>Mail, Contacts, Calendars>Your email account>Account>Outgoing mail server - tap the server name next to SMTP and check in the primary server and make sure your username and password are entered and correct - even if it says that the password is optional.
